The 2003 France Europa 1 kilo silver coin (50 Euro) is an impressive and rare release from the Monnaie de Paris, created as a tribute to Europe and the unity of the eurozone. With a strictly limited mintage of just 10,000 coins worldwide, this is a true showpiece for collectors and silver enthusiasts who appreciate large-format issues.
Struck in 1 kilo of sterling silver (92.5% silver / 0.925), this coin combines substantial weight with a distinctive artistic and historical design. Inspired by octopuses represented in Minoan art, it features the names of the twelve eurozone countries arranged in elegant, flowing curves:
Belgium / België, Deutschland, Eire, España, France, Ellada, Italia, Luxembourg, Nederland, Österreich, Portugal, Suomi.
At the ends of the “tentacles,” the coin displays the three French euro coin designs, along with the initials RF. The composition is completed by the twelve stars of Europe and the bold face value 50 EURO, symbolising France’s unique identity within Europe’s diversity.
